**Vendor note: Inkmill markdown pipeline**

Rendering for Parchway docs is outsourced to Inkmill under an annual contract, renewing each March. They handle sanitization and PDF export; we own the upload queue. SLA: 4-hour response on rendering failures. Escalate only after two failed retries. Their support desk is reachable at the address below.

billing contact of hahaf-baguf = zorael.tammir.jorius@sivrelhq.internal

**Facilities Ticket — Wellness Room Booking (Fernley Building)**

Request: Wellness room, level 3, reserved Thursday 10:00–11:00 for the Larkspur fit-out crew. Please leave the room as found, lights off, and blinds open on departure. Bookings over one hour must go through the facilities desk. The wellness room door is kept locked between bookings, so use the code below.

badge for fafop-fajof: bdg-Z-47

Subject: Handover — Pinebridge health checks

Hey team,

Quick handover before I'm out. The Lanternworks API nodes behind the balancer now answer on /healthz instead of /ping, so if support sees 502s, check that first — the old path was retired Tuesday. Rotation happens Friday; Marit owns the cutover. To push the updated check config to the balancer fleet you'll need the deploy key, which is pasted just below.

signing key of fahof-tahof = bky13_rpcUNgEnLB4i2

**Mgmt Meeting Minutes — Retiring the Brightline Range**

Quick recap for sales leads at Fenholt Supplies: we agreed to retire the Brightline fixture range by year-end. Remaining stock moves to clearance pricing next month, and accounts on standing orders get migrated to the Lumetta range. Trade-in incentives were approved in principle. The confidential note on next steps sits just below.

board note of bajof-bajeg: The pricing group signed off on a budget of $13.4 million for Project Sildor. The renewal with Lamixek Holdings closes at $48.9 million a year, 49 percent above the last contract.

## Releases

Hey support folks — quick notes on ProfileMesh shard releases. Each release re-balances user-profile shards gradually, so don't panic if a lookup lands on a stale shard for a few minutes post-deploy; it self-heals. Release bundles are published twice a month and are always signed. If a customer asks you to verify a bundle they downloaded, walk them through the checksum step using the public signing key below.

deploy key for kawif-bageg: bky19_YQNdHDgpaLxUNwPoHm9